Legerstee, 2005

'가리키기‘ (pointing)와 '눈맞추기‘ (eye-

contacting)는 인간의 본유적능력으로서, 실제로이러한 몸짓을 하지 못하는 아동은 마치 자폐아와같이 나중에 의사소통 능력이 저하되거나 또는발달되지 않는다고 논의한 바 있다. 실제로,

정상적으로 성장하는 아가의 경우, 사전에 훈련을받지 않아도 눈맞추기와 가리키기 행동을 하며, 이행동이 정상적으로 발달되어야 언어 습득이이루어질 수 있다고 한다.

Pollick & de Waal (2007)

침팬지 34마리와 보노보 13마리를

16개월간 연구.

침팬지와 보노보의 의사소통에 18개의 얼굴표정 및 음성 신호, 31개의 몸짓이 사용되고있다는 것을 발견.

Page 9: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Pollick & de Waal (2007) -계속

(가) 얼굴 표정과 음성 신호들은 모든 동물들이 거의 유사한방법으로 사용.

(나) 동일한 형태의 몸짓이 맥락에따라서로다른의미로사용되고 있었음.

(다) 보노보는침팬지보다 훨씬 더융통성있는방법으로여러표현들을조합하여사용. 침팬지와는 달리 음성신호와얼굴표정을함께사용할수 있었음.

Page 10: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Pollick & de Waal (2007) - 결론

침팬지와 보노보 언어도 인간의 언어처럼구조적으로 보편적이고 또한 형태와 의미의 관계도자의적 (arbitrariness)일 가능성을 시사함.

이 논문에서 Pollick & de Waal은몸짓과 표현을다양하게 조합할 줄 아는 보노보의 능력은 인간언어의 진화와 관계가 있을 것이라고 관망했다.

(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, 2007)

Elinor Ochs Language Socialization

As children learn appropriate ways of

speaking, they also learn important

cultural values and ideals of personhood.

They learn to act like someone of their

social position, gender, ethnic group, etc.

Peer socialization

• When children go to school, peers become the main vehicle for their socialization into particular roles (e.g. developing ideas of “being a good friend”)

• Child peer groups often span several years at a time (through siblings, neighborhood friends, etc.) allowing for games and verbal art to be passed down from generation to generation.

Page 18: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Acquisition and Socialization

• Language acquisition refers to the process

of a child/baby acquiring language for the

first time

• Language socialization refers to the

process by which a child gains

communicative competence and is

socialized into a group through language

Page 19: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Children are socialized INTO a linguistic and

cultural system, but children are also

socialized THROUGH language into social

roles and models of behavior

Page 20: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Language acquisition is sometimes

treated by child development

researchers as a mechanical process of

activating an innate capacity that is

minimally accessible to cultural

influence (e.g., Chomsky).

BUT culture surrounds child language

learning, including the significance of

learning language, rules for appropriate

use (Ochs, MacWhinney 등emergentists), and so forth.

What are kids really learning?

Example: Ochs’ research on dinner-table conversation in California

Conversation focuses on children’s activities

Mom does all the conversational work to guide the story

Everyone turns to Dad for a moral judgment at the end.

Becoming Human

What is the first question we ask about a

newborn? Are babies “human”?

Ochs and Schieffelin compare 3 cultures

with regard to ideas about babies and

language development (US middle class,

Samoa, Kaluli)

Page 23: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

U.S. White Middle Class

• Infants are treated as a social being.

• Child is directly addressed. Caregivers

may answer for the child.

• Adults accommodate to children. (e.g.

baby talk, baby-proofing)

Page 24: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Kaluli (Papua New Guinea)

• Babies are “soft” and “have no understanding”

• Caregivers speak “for” babies; don’t modify speech much to accommodate

until it says mother (naw) and breast (bo)

Page 26: Language and Cognition 조숙환ocw.sogang.ac.kr/rfile/2015/Language Cognition/OCW3309(12... · 2016-01-25 · William Wordsworth MY heart leaps up when I behold A rainbow in the

Many rules for interaction are not explicitly

taught. Children learn them through

experience.

• Eye contact

• Interruption patterns

• How to get a turn speaking

• When to stop speaking

• What topics are discussed and what aren’t

discussed, and with whom

Recursion:Chomsky vs. Everett/Jackendoff/Pinker

Chomsky:

syntactic categories (NP, VP, S, etc.) recur by

allowing an embedding to be repeated in a

hierarchical manner.

Everett (1995년 이후계속):

Piraha 언어 (Amazon)에는 embedding 구조가없음.

Jackendoff/Pinker (2004, 2005 - )

‘회귀성’은 인간 언어의 특징의 일부에 불과하므로, 언어 지식의생성을 어느 날 갑자기 두뇌의 성장이나 형태의 법칙에서 비롯된‘부산물’ 또는 ‘삼각소간’ (spandrel)으로 총체적으로진화되었다고 설명할 수 없다.

핑커 (2003): 마음은여러도구가집합적으로모여있는 ‘Swiss

army knife’ 같은것으로서, 마치 Pleistocene (홍적세) 시대 (1만-

160만년전)에 우리의 조상들이 그때그때 당면한 일을완수하면서 형성된, 자연선택 (natural selection)의결실로보아야한다. 인간의 언어는 소리, 형태, 문장구조, 담화 등 매우다양한 특징과 복잡하면서 서로 독립적인 지식 구조가 담겨 있기때문에, 어느 날 갑자기 인간의 두뇌에 변화가 생긴 부산물에의해 진화가 발생했으리라는 가설은 언어의 본질을 반영하지못한다
